SANFORD, N.C. — Sanford residents held a candelight vigil Thursday evening on the street where a 17-year-old girl was fatally shot in the head.

Witnesses said they heard multiple shots before police officers found Shamika Nikkia Lett, 17, lying in the street at Hickory Avenue and Fourth Street Wednesday evening. She died after being flown to UNC Hospitals.

Residents said they burned candles, prayed and cried together at the vigil. A teddy bear and boquet of roses lay next to a sign with pictures of Lett.

Police have not discussed a motive in the shooting or said if any arrests have been made.
